Takuzu, also known as Binairo, is a logic puzzle involving placement of two symbols, often 1s and 0s, on a rectangular grid. The objective is to fill the grid with 1s and 0s, where there is an equal number of 1s and 0s in each row and column and no more than two of either number adjacent to each other.

A local binary pattern is called uniform if the binary pattern contains at most two 0-1 or 1-0 transitions. For example, 00010000 (2 transitions) is a uniform pattern, but 01010100 (6 transitions) is not.
In the binary game, one is given a fixed subset X of the set {0,1} N of all sequences of 0s and 1s. The players take it in turn to choose a digit 0 or 1, and the first player wins if the sequence they form lies in the set X. Gokigen Naname is played on a rectangular grid in which numbers in circles appear at some of the intersections on the grid.. The object is to draw diagonal lines in each cell of the grid, such that the number in each circle equals the number of lines extending from that circle.
Nurikabe (hiragana: ぬりかべ) is a binary determination puzzle named for Nurikabe, an invisible wall in Japanese folklore that blocks roads and delays foot travel. Nurikabe was apparently invented and named by the publisher Nikoli ; other names (and attempts at localization) for the puzzle include Cell Structure and Islands in the Stream .
